Like and you can Tinder: link community within universities [excerpt]

As the their launch from inside the 2012, Tinder-brand new debatable relationships app-might have been cause for talk. Tinder is actually certainly one of the first software having swiping possibilities, enabling pages in order to swipe sometimes right otherwise kept towards the a good variety of character photographs of anyone close. Several users who swipe directly on you to another’s users commonly “suits,” gives all of them the capacity to begin a discussion.

Regarding the lower than excerpt of your own Happiness Perception, journalist Donna Freitas shows on the interviews which have university students just who shared the skills toward Tinder.

Within the an on-line survey, pupils was indeed requested to mention all the social media networks they use on a regular basis. Of one’s college students who answered that it question, merely nine% told you they use Tinder continuously.

Once the Tinder uses GPS, you could practically restrict your options to someone for the university. That will be just what pair children whom utilize it would. They normally use they in order to flirt. State there is a lovely people in your physics group however, you never in reality https://kissbrides.com/no/blogg/asiatiske-kvinner-vs-amerikanske-kvinner/ fulfilled your? Possibly the guy shows up on Tinder if you find yourself caught toward they some Saturday nights together with your nearest and dearest. This enables that swipe right on their photo-and you can guarantee you to definitely elizabeth on the images). In either case, voila: once you swipe best, you tell him you are curious.

Maybe nothing goes from there-possibly the guy never responds, maybe he does nevertheless never actually communicate with your from inside the person. Or perhaps next time the thing is your you actually have good conversation just like the you have built a link to the Tinder. Tinder can provide a hole to speak with individuals you have always thought try glamorous. Pupils yes see it incredibly difficult to introduce one beginning-actually going up so you’re able to some body toward campus your already come across glamorous and you will claiming hello, myself, boggles the heads. Of course, immediately after a connection is created towards Tinder, whether or not it contributes to something it’ll be a connections, maybe not a date. Link community reigns over campuses. Relationships (no less than of one’s more traditional kinds) is almost nonexistent, even when students would like not getting the way it is. It’s obviously correct that pupils don’t know ideas on how to go out any more. However it is as well as correct that very people really wants to time if they you will definitely. Tinder will help reduce its concerns and you may anxieties around one to first conference (although it cannot always function that way).

But what I wish to high light is your character Tinder have throughout the mass media, therefore the concerns stoked from the alarmists-one Tinder just facilitates sex anywhere between strangers-doesn’t seem to pertain to your college or university campuses. For those who create from time to time play with Tinder locate hookups, it’s almost always hookups together with other students. Additionally, for college students, hookups are a standard category-they may be everything from making out (and it is will only kissing) so you’re able to sex. Thus although students spends Tinder to help you spark a link, one to connection get simply end up in an evening of making away with a unique pupil.

A comparable hate one to youngsters experience dating–the sense you to definitely fulfilling somebody with whom you don’t have any prior real world union try irresponsible-applies to Tinder also. People could possibly wish to have sex and you may hook up, but they don’t want to has actually sex and you will hook that have anonymous complete strangers. They would like to has sex and you will link with this scorching guy out of Western illuminated, or that hot girl from chemistry group. No matter if he has got zero prior official addition otherwise reference to see your face, the truth that the body is a known amounts-they sit in your own university, you really have a category with these people, maybe even a few of friends learn this person or discover the fresh new household members for the people-transform the brand new active entirely. For better or for worse (and i also would state to have greatest total), this makes the individual that have who you are teasing sufficient reason for who you you will should get together “safer.” He’s “safer” regarding attention away from people because you are attending come across all of them again inside the group, since you may score a feeling of the profile off anyone else in advance of something happens anywhere between your, as you likely know already their current address or will get away effortlessly or even, and because there are next entry to all of them if the need getting since they live and you will see college on your own university and they are limited by its guidelines and you may regulators. Supplied, that isn’t a make sure that a hookup commonly churn out well, and it is not a guarantee against sexual assault. But, even with fears expressed from the mass media, pupils almost never play with Tinder to satisfy overall complete strangers.

Tinder, if you are inside, is simply a helpful tool for proving focus, perhaps having flirting, and you can obviously getting a quick pride improve if someone means one. Try Tinder part of relationship people into the campus? Obviously. It depends abreast of the newest campus, due to the fact Tinder is much more preferred to the particular campuses than the others. And you will connection people try dominating toward university campuses a long time before Tinder was devised. Hookups happens aside from programs and you may social networking, therefore when you find yourself social networking play a part into the connections community, it truly don’t carry out connection community. And in case social media would be to drop-off the next day, the effect towards link people could well be almost nonexistent.
